Taney County Marriages
1885-1900

Originally compiled by the DAR--
Taneycomo Chapter (1966)

(indexed and published with permission)


 
The Taney County courthouse burned twice during the Civil War, and again in December 1885, during the Bald Knobber Era.  Some couples chose to have their marriages re-entered in the records after this last fire, but most did not...therefore, unless there are Bible records or some family-held copy of the marriage license, official marriage records prior to Dec 1885 do not exist.  There is ongoing research into the WPA records on microfilm at the MO State Archives, which include church records--these may give us more information in the near future.
